A knee replacement infection can occur any time after surgery. You may develop a minor infection in the hospital or when you go home. Symptoms of Infection After Hip or Knee Replacement In the days and weeks following your surgery, watch for symptoms that include: fevers (more than 101F), chills, excessive redness (cellulitis), opening wound edges, prolonged or excessive wound drainage, cloudy wound drainage, and foul smells. Superficial infections usually occur soon after your surgery.
